Gloucester, MA - Where to watch game  
jintsmcgee : 11/24/2015 12:21 pm : link
Minglewood Tavern (25 Rogers Street in Gloucester)...its connected to Lat 43 Restaurant....They have lots of TV's....great food...
Best thing to do is get there a little early and tell bartender/waitress what game you want to watch...they would do it for me all the time....especially since Pats aren't on this Sunday should be no problem..I know Gloucester well..grew up around there....
